Position Overview

We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Land Surveying Intern to support our surveying team in the field. This internship offers an excellent opportunity to gain hands-on experience with advanced surveying techniques, tools, and processes.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support field surveyors in executing a range of construction survey activities
  • Collect and record information using robotic total stations, digital levels, and GPS equipment
  • Assist in interpreting field data to create precise topographic plans, including downloading, processing and editing the collected data
  • Explore and document geographical information from the landscape
  • Verify elevations, volumes, and locations of existing structures and services
  • Assist in determining and laying out land boundaries
  • Assist in the layout of fill areas, preload corners, and building locations
  • Liaise with project managers, contractors, and members of the public under the supervision of the survey team.
  • Clear brush and debris from survey lines when required
  • Transport survey equipment safely
  • Work safely within defined safety protocols and contribute to maintaining a safe work environment
  • Assist in the calculation, analysis and computation of measurements gathered during field surveys
  • Maintain an organized library of site records, measurements, and survey data
  • Perform other duties as required
  • Desired Skills and Experience

  • Currently enrolled in a post-secondary or college institution, pursuing a degree in Geomatics, Civil Engineering, or a related field
  • Basic knowledge of conventional survey instruments, robotic total stations, digital levels, and GPS equipment is preferred
  • Familiarity with computer applications such as Civil3D, AutoCAD, and Microsoft Office is an asset
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• A valid driver’s license and access to a vehicle
